Brand
of HERO (BOH) is
an alternative/hard rock band out of Orange County, Calif. BOH's music
is an original repertoire of sophisticated alternative rock songs with
a modern energy of hard rock. Their music style is a mix of influences
from rock, grunge, blues, alternative, and modern rock with a message
like Skillet, Switchfoot, P.O.D. and Life House. Fans say BOH reminds
them of bands like Collective Soul, Smashing Pumpkins and Life House
to Stone Temple Pilots and Oasis. BOH was originally formed in 1996
as "Bridge of Hope", but changed their name in 2004 to Brand of Hero.
BOH
has independently released and marketed two EP/CDs, RIPPLEaffect
(2004) and Impacto (2008).. BOH is in the midst of recording their full
CD, which they are hoping to release sometime in early 2018. However,
at the request of fans and industry, they will be pre-releasing the
EP/CD, On this Side of the Ocean in June 2017 to represent a taste of
what's to come on their upcoming full CD release.
Winning
the '04 Orange County Music Awards Best Hard Rock category for their
song RIPPLEaffect, on their self titled EP/CD has allowed the band more
opportunities.. But even with this opportunity their vision has stayed
the same - communicating a message of Love, Mercy, and Grace in a different
tone, through their own form of hard rock music. Band founder, singer-songwriter
and guitar player, Art Anthony, believes the purpose of the band "is
not about fame, popularity, or money . . . it's about getting an optimistic
message across to others through the music and the lyrics we present,
in this day and age", Art said, as well as doing music that a wide audience
would love and enjoy. The most important thing Art wants to do is to
do what he loves most and that is playing and singing in an alternative-rock
band that would share his faith to a broader audience. "We believe we're
a rock band, with the gift of music, to make a difference in both main-stream
and Christian arenas alike," he continued...
The
band is comprised of
Art
Anthony (songwriter, rhythm guitars, lead vocals), who happens to be
the founder of the band, returning lead guitar, Matt Rizzo, drummer,
Chris Mohney (Monz) and bassist, Jenny Torres.. The band members come
from different musical influences and backgrounds, yet have bonded to
together as a collective band. The band members consider themselves
to be a "rock band" with a positive message of their faith. Their music
range is phenomenal along with their talent to perform on stage. The
band has played at The House of Blues, The Coach House, The Viper Room,
The Knitting Factory, The Whisky a Go Go, Federal Bar and Galaxy Theatre
opening for such bands as The Kry, Kevin Martin and the Hiwatts (Voice
of Candlebox), LA Guns, The Romantics, to doing ministry benefit concerts
at local churches opening for Jeremy Camp, or an indie band like Pound
Foolish to playing festivals like Portico (TomFest) and sharing stages
with Emery, Showbread, Rock & Roll Worship Circus, Joy Electric and
others. The band crosses all types of stereotype barriers to create
what they feel is their own form of cross-over rock, alternative rock
and hard rock. Other recognized national acts BOH has opened for includes:
Dramarama, Winger, FogHat, Joe Lynn Turner (from Rainbow and Deep Purple),
The BulletBoys, Vanilla Fudge, Colin Hay (from Men at Work), Michael
Sweet (from Stryper), Tommy TuTone, along with well known local artist,
such as Union of Saints, Plumbline, Pax217, East West, Mudbath, Nevada
Sky, Silent Noise, Apulse, Scarlet Crush, Makeshift 3 and others.

In the
EP/CD RIPPLEaffect, two of the songs,
RIPPLEaffect and Carry, were independently released in June 2003, along
with a hidden track GIVER, as the CD single RIPPLEaffect for radio play.
The song RIPPLEaffect received great reviews from friends and fans and
was selected to be on a couple of compilation CDs the previous year,
which included Musician Institute's (MI) 2004 compilation CD (Hollywood).
In addition, BOH won the '04 Orange County Music Awards 'Best Hard Rock'
category for their song RIPPLEaffect. Also, BOH attained radio play
on 95.9 FM, The FISH, on the Fresh Fish Friday program with the song,
GIVER (Project N EP), which received some good reviews. The RIPPLEaffect
